Magnetic lock does not work

Moderate success. The magnet that's supposed to keep the keyboard closed on the front of the iPad isn't strong enough to do the job. The keyboard just won't stay in place when closed, requiring it to fit snugly in transit, as if the two pieces were just bumping together. I don't expect to be able to pick up the iPad by the key covers (vice versa), but I expected them to at least stay closed when carrying them. The rest of the keyboard is pretty good. The keys are necessarily tight, but at least as easy to use as any other iPad mini keyboard. Battery life is excellent and pairing works as advertised. The iPad slot/hinge is amazing and really makes this case stand out. However, there are lighter Bluetooth keyboards out there (Logitech themselves make a very good one like this) and since this keyboard (physically) connects and holds so poorly, that's no reason to settle for a smaller keyboard or a premium one.
